Output fc279d6b8dd913fcf65638b3ad9e1eaaca264dc64ec23aeb6e9e3442f8a92868:0

value
20855701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f5c089be213f40add169572ce5c34e635afb75 OP_EQUAL
address
3M73aNFTNLhzEbxUZcVjuZmfoF1tv2ksbf
transaction
fc279d6b8dd913fcf65638b3ad9e1eaaca264dc64ec23aeb6e9e3442f8a92868
confirmations
291361
spent
true